自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 显现eclipse编辑器的任务栏

显现任务栏

2022-06-21 15:01:09 401 1

原创 eclipse编辑器对于中文乱码的处理方式

eclipse

2022-06-21 14:55:02 171

原创 字符串处理005

字符串处理今天的是一个字符串匹配的问题:题目006 最长字符后缀思路分析:字符串从后面开始进行字符串的匹配,其中需要注意的是找出字符串的最小长度(这个可以理解为是一个小技巧),还要不断更新这个长度,原因是当出现不一样的字符时,也就是当前字符不匹配,那么说明当前len长度过长,需要更新len。代码如下:#include <iostream>#include <string>using namespace std;const int maxn = 210;int n

2022-01-29 09:07:13 843

原创 字符串处理004

今天的问题挺大的因为我自己再写的时候没有做出来看的是一位同学的解法、先说一下题目吧:题目006 字符串最大跨距题意还是挺明确的,还是应用的那个kmp暴力算法。记录一下正确的代码,明天还会继续处理这道题目。代码如下:#include <iostream>#include <string>#include <sstream>#include <cstdio>using namespace std;int main(){ string

2022-01-26 23:02:58 638

原创 字符串处理003

打卡第三天,昨天有点事情没来得及写,今天就补上昨天的题目。今天是字符串kmp暴力算法和string函数库中的substr函数。题目004 字符串的移位运算(kmp暴力算法)题目分析:关键点:1.需要判断两个字符串 的长度大小。2.需要枚举位置移动后的字符串。3.利用判断暴力kmp匹配字符串。代码如下:#include <iostream>#include <string>using namespace std;bool judge(string str, s

2022-01-25 23:10:40 533

原创 字符串处理002

今天两道题目,思路和方法和昨天的同源采用的还是双指针算法题目002最长单词废话不多说直接上代码:#include <iostream>#include <string>using namespace std;int main(){ string str, maxstr; getline(cin, str); // 需要读入空格 int maxlen = 0; for(int i = 0; i < str.size

2022-01-23 23:28:08 336

原创 字符串处理001

字符串定义:一串字符的集合,理解为以’\0’结尾的字符数组。字符和整数的关系ASCII码一一对应关系。几个较为重要的字符对应关系:‘A’ 65‘a’ 97‘0’ 48一般描述字符串的时候采用的是string类原因是功能更加强大使用起来更加方便。引用头文件<string>介绍一个函数的用法:sort函数对两个迭代器(或指针)指定的部分进行快速排序,第三个参数可以传入定义大小比较的函数,或者是对小于号的重载实现的是从小到大进行排序int a[maxn];b

2022-01-22 23:32:04 293

原创 c语言之选择排序法

c语言之选择排序法啊,这是我第一次写文章,可能会有很多不足,希望大家可以给我指出。问题 : 选择法排序题目描述输入一个正整数n,再输入n个整数,将他们从大到小排序后输出。样例输入52 5 1 3 4样例输出5 4 3 2 1//精髓就是要交换数值大小 ;#include<stdio.h>int main(){ int n; scanf("%d",&n);//定义有多少数 ; int i,a[n]; for(i=0;i<n;i++) { s

2022-01-21 22:44:15 5092 11

原创 寒假之规划

寒假来了,准确的说是已经过去半个月了,本来早就应该开始做这期文章了,额额。。好像距离上次写文章有一段时间了,不过问题不大,可能会有友友问我,咋过去折磨长时间才开始啊,这里十分抱歉,我个人有点情绪原因所以就没有更新,咳咳…不过阴霾已经过去,即日起每天更新我学习的算法题和做题遇到的心得,题目可能有点杂,不过我会尽力总结好,还有就是其他方面的学习心得。今天就不在更新算法了,主要就是想列一下寒假刷题的规划,预计是更新70-80道算法题左右其中以acwing上面的为主,当然还会有落谷上面的。由于作者要备考蓝桥杯和c

2022-01-21 22:20:01 332

原创 算法训练第一题

备战算法之路链接:https://ac.nowcoder.com/acm/contest/12794/A来源:牛客网题目描述Professor Boolando can only think in binary, or more specifically, in powers of 2. He converts any number you give him to the smallest power of 2 that is equal to or greater than your number

2021-03-14 21:46:32 98

原创 运用指针实现将字符串中的数字倒序输出其他元素不变

##用指针编写程序,实现输入一个字符串后,将其中出现的所有数字进行倒置。(注:字符串长度 n<100)样例输入:a%#dg235SF86&e9样例输出:a%#dg968SF53&e2今天写这篇文章我很激动。标题上所描述的就是这道题的题目。这道题是我们老师出的一道实验题,我呢就胡乱写上去了,今天宿舍室友和我花了很长时间去研究它,总的来说是我室友坚持不懈的精神感染了我;因为我们俩都比较菜,我呢又懒,苦思冥想了n+1种方案,还是没有做出来;然后就去百度去搜,但是找到了一种解法源

2020-12-09 00:15:33 1273 2

原创 统计英语单词的个数c语言

CET-4就要来临了,不知道大家准备得怎么样了? CET-4一般要求写一篇英文小作文,字数一般在120字以内,评阅试卷的老师希望准确的知道每篇作文的字数,但是又不想直接数,那样太累了。英语教研室的老师找到了老师帮忙,老师一看这个题目太简单了,于是就交给了聪明能干的你,已知英语老师已经通过某种手段将英语作文扫描了下来,那么请你准确的统计有多少个字(单词),已知英文短文中只包含英文字母和标点符号。输入包括一行:一段英文作文,字符数量 <= 1000输出包括一个正整数,表示单词的数量样例输入A

2020-12-07 17:08:14 2682 2

原创 小明分蛋糕问题c语言求解

问题描述  小明今天生日,他有n块蛋糕要分给朋友们吃,这n块蛋糕(编号为1到n)的重量分别为a1, a2, …, an。小明想分给每个朋友至少重量为k的蛋糕。小明的朋友们已经排好队准备领蛋糕,对于每个朋友,小明总是先将自己手中编号最小的蛋糕分给他,当这个朋友所分得蛋糕的重量不到k时,再继续将剩下的蛋糕中编号~~最小~~ 的给他,直到小明的蛋糕分完或者这个朋友分到的蛋糕的总重量大于等于k。  请问当小明的蛋糕分完时,总共有多少个朋友分到了蛋糕。输入格式  输入的第一行包含了两个整数n, k,意义如上所

2020-12-07 00:27:25 1020

原创 ##c语言之杨辉三角

c语言之杨辉三角打印n行杨辉三角,n<10。输入格式:直接输入一个小于10的正整数n。输出格式:输出n行杨辉三角,每个数据输出用空格分开。输入样例:5输出样例:11 11 2 11 3 3 11 4 6 4 1#include<stdio.h>int main(){ int n; scanf("%d",&n);//输入一个整数; int a[n][n];//定义二维数组; int i,j

2020-11-30 21:51:49 624

原创 小明种苹果问题

ccf-201909-01小明种苹果CCF201909-1 小明种苹果题目描述小明在他的果园里种了一些苹果树。为了保证苹果的品质,在种植过程中要进行若干轮疏果操作,也就是提前从树上把不好的苹果去掉。第一轮疏果操作开始前,小明记录了每棵树上苹果的个数。每轮疏果操作时,小明都记录了从每棵树上去掉的苹果个数。在最后一轮疏果操作结束后,请帮助小明统计相关的信息。输入从标准输入读入数据。第1行包含两个正整数N和M,分别表示苹果树的棵数和疏果操作的轮数。第1+i行(1<= i <= N),每行

2020-11-29 17:08:30 359

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除